What is a late rent payment notice?

A late rent payment notice is a letter sent by a landlord or property manager to remind a tenant that their rent payment is overdue.
legal documents graphic

When should you use a late rent payment notice?

You should use a late rent payment notice when a tenant has not paid rent by the due date and you want to formally remind them of their obligation.
legal documents graphic

What should be in a late rent payment notice?

A late rent payment notice should include the amount owed, any late fees, the payment due date, and clear instructions for resolving the overdue payment.

The Legal Risk Score of a Late Rent Payment Notice Template is Low

Our legal team have marked this document as low risk considering:

  • The document does not specify the exact amount of rent due or the total amount overdue, which could lead to misunderstandings between the landlord and tenant regarding the exact financial obligations.
  • The notice mentions that "further action will be taken" if payment is not received by a certain date, but it does not detail what these actions could entail, potentially leaving the tenant uncertain about the possible repercussions of non-payment.
  • The document states that the issuer can be contacted via a number below, but does not actually provide a contact number, which could hinder communication efforts to resolve the payment issue efficiently.
